孫杰賢
7月9日,藍(lán)汛通信(ChinaCache )發(fā)布了2013年第二季度全國(guó)互聯(lián)網(wǎng)感知數(shù)據(jù)報(bào)告。根據(jù)藍(lán)汛網(wǎng)絡(luò)感知平臺(tái)CC Index數(shù)據(jù)顯示,2M以上感知帶寬達(dá)到53.96%。其中,超寬感知帶寬占比持續(xù)上漲,而窄帶寬感知基本消失。從全國(guó)各地區(qū)感知網(wǎng)速來(lái)看,整體感知網(wǎng)速都有增長(zhǎng),東部和西部差距在逐漸減小。其中,東部感知網(wǎng)速達(dá)到3.42Mb/s,環(huán)比增長(zhǎng)9.96%;中部地區(qū)感知網(wǎng)速為3.07 Mb/s,環(huán)比增加9.25%;而西部地區(qū)感知網(wǎng)速為2.96Mb/s ,環(huán)比增加12.98%。
上述數(shù)據(jù)只是平均值,具體到各地區(qū),其差距依然很大。從各省市來(lái)看,上海仍然一枝獨(dú)秀,感知網(wǎng)速超過(guò)5Mb/s,達(dá)到5.10Mb/s,是唯一 一個(gè)感知網(wǎng)速超過(guò)5Mb/s 的地區(qū);江蘇排名第二,但與上海還有差距,感知網(wǎng)速為3.64Mb/s;北京緊隨其后,排名第三,感知網(wǎng)速為3.61Mb/s;最低點(diǎn)出現(xiàn)在青海,感知網(wǎng)速僅為2.46Mb/s 。
藍(lán)汛是中國(guó)領(lǐng)先的專業(yè)CDN服務(wù)提供商,在全國(guó)多個(gè)城市擁有服務(wù)節(jié)點(diǎn),覆蓋中國(guó)電信、中國(guó)聯(lián)通、中國(guó)移動(dòng)和中國(guó)教育科研網(wǎng)等各大運(yùn)營(yíng)商,能夠向用戶提供全方位的內(nèi)容感知網(wǎng)絡(luò)服務(wù)。CC Index網(wǎng)絡(luò)感知平臺(tái)基于藍(lán)汛遍布全國(guó)各級(jí)城市的服務(wù)節(jié)點(diǎn)、眾多網(wǎng)絡(luò)客戶實(shí)時(shí)收集的數(shù)據(jù),構(gòu)成一份精確而全面的互聯(lián)網(wǎng)狀況全景圖。用戶可以在任何時(shí)候、任何地方查看全國(guó)網(wǎng)絡(luò)動(dòng)態(tài)——數(shù)據(jù)移動(dòng)有多快、最擁堵的地方在哪里、 全國(guó)網(wǎng)速最快的省份在哪?
CC Index平臺(tái)每天都有30多億條的數(shù)據(jù)和分析的結(jié)果上傳到工信部的平臺(tái)上,平臺(tái)最核心的一點(diǎn)就是大數(shù)據(jù)的分析和開(kāi)發(fā)。因?yàn)橹挥蟹治龀鰯?shù)據(jù),并且量化看這個(gè)數(shù)據(jù)的時(shí)候才知道互聯(lián)網(wǎng)在發(fā)生什么樣的改變,才知道哪些客戶需要什么樣的服務(wù)。
其實(shí),無(wú)論大數(shù)據(jù)還是云計(jì)算都與CDN和內(nèi)容感知網(wǎng)絡(luò)有著天然的耦合性,這對(duì)藍(lán)汛的基礎(chǔ)設(shè)施自然也提出了極高的要求。宗劼是藍(lán)汛負(fù)責(zé)研發(fā)和CDN平臺(tái)架構(gòu)的副總裁,他認(rèn)為面對(duì)云計(jì)算和大數(shù)據(jù),對(duì)于藍(lán)汛這樣的CDN服務(wù)提供商來(lái)說(shuō),在架構(gòu)設(shè)計(jì)層面有“三個(gè)能力”的打造最為關(guān)鍵:計(jì)算能力、存儲(chǔ)能力和網(wǎng)絡(luò)支撐能力。
以藍(lán)汛的重要客戶群電商企業(yè)為例,僅僅依靠單點(diǎn)或多點(diǎn)的IDC服務(wù)是無(wú)法滿足其大規(guī)模并發(fā)和快速響應(yīng)的。從資源分布的角度,IDC的覆蓋面無(wú)法與CDN相比。同時(shí)傳統(tǒng)的CDN也無(wú)法100%解決電商分發(fā)問(wèn)題。因此藍(lán)汛需要對(duì)自身的CDN平臺(tái)進(jìn)行升級(jí)改造,這主要關(guān)系到以下幾方面的因素:動(dòng)態(tài)、靜態(tài)業(yè)務(wù)分離;提供強(qiáng)大的并發(fā)性能;靈活的資源調(diào)度能力。為了提升動(dòng)態(tài)、靜態(tài)業(yè)務(wù)的處理能力,藍(lán)汛的CDN平臺(tái)無(wú)疑需要具備強(qiáng)大的處理性能。為了達(dá)到這一目標(biāo),藍(lán)汛為每個(gè)節(jié)點(diǎn)配備了至強(qiáng)E5系列處理器。新的Sandy Bridge架構(gòu)相較于前一代產(chǎn)品有了40%以上的性能提升,對(duì)于藍(lán)汛來(lái)說(shuō),每個(gè)節(jié)點(diǎn)的處理能力提升40%以上,無(wú)論是動(dòng)態(tài)業(yè)務(wù)還是靜態(tài)業(yè)務(wù)都能應(yīng)對(duì)自如。同時(shí),藍(lán)汛還利用了至強(qiáng)E5處理器的新特性進(jìn)行軟件層面的技術(shù)升級(jí),E5的多核心多線程技術(shù)可以進(jìn)行虛擬化擴(kuò)展,1臺(tái)服務(wù)器可以虛擬出2臺(tái)甚至更多的虛擬主機(jī)來(lái)進(jìn)行內(nèi)容分發(fā),這也極大的提升了內(nèi)容分發(fā)效率。
電商之外,視頻的爆發(fā)也讓藍(lán)汛的存儲(chǔ)需求驟增,比原來(lái)多了上百倍。據(jù)宗劼介紹,藍(lán)汛在全國(guó)大概有500多個(gè)節(jié)點(diǎn),在每個(gè)節(jié)點(diǎn)有超過(guò)100個(gè)T的存儲(chǔ)能力。面對(duì)如此之大的存儲(chǔ)需求,磁盤成為分發(fā)節(jié)點(diǎn)的最大瓶頸,傳統(tǒng)磁盤150左右的IOPS很難應(yīng)對(duì)大規(guī)模的并發(fā)訪問(wèn)。配合至強(qiáng)E5系列處理器,藍(lán)汛引入英特爾SSD技術(shù)。在單盤對(duì)比上看,傳統(tǒng)磁盤只有150IOPS,而SSD能達(dá)到3萬(wàn)以上的IOPS,這種變化顯然是革命性的。在E5與SSD的配合下,單個(gè)服務(wù)器處理性能較以往提升了5倍以上。性能提升的同時(shí),響應(yīng)時(shí)間也隨之縮短,傳統(tǒng)磁盤的響應(yīng)時(shí)間為5~13ms,而SSD的響應(yīng)時(shí)間只有0.5ms,十幾毫秒的提升足以讓藍(lán)汛在與其他CDN廠商的競(jìng)爭(zhēng)中搶占先機(jī)。SSD雖然存在寫(xiě)入壽命的問(wèn)題,但是在過(guò)去一年的測(cè)試和計(jì)算后得出的結(jié)論是:以藍(lán)汛的業(yè)務(wù)類型,單塊SSD完全具備10以上的使用壽命。
有關(guān)大數(shù)據(jù)存儲(chǔ)還有一個(gè)現(xiàn)實(shí)的問(wèn)題就是I/O瓶頸。面對(duì)大數(shù)據(jù),傳統(tǒng)的存儲(chǔ)子系統(tǒng)已經(jīng)難以滿足海量數(shù)據(jù)處理的讀寫(xiě)需要,數(shù)據(jù)傳輸I/O帶寬的瓶頸愈發(fā)突出。因此,數(shù)據(jù)密集型計(jì)算系統(tǒng)在系統(tǒng)結(jié)構(gòu)方面面臨的最大挑戰(zhàn)其實(shí)是如何在存儲(chǔ)超大規(guī)模數(shù)據(jù)量的同時(shí),保證存儲(chǔ)系統(tǒng)與計(jì)算系統(tǒng)之間的I/O帶寬。由于至強(qiáng)E5處理器采用了IIO技術(shù)和DDIO技術(shù),可以有效應(yīng)對(duì)大數(shù)據(jù)流量,針對(duì)所有I/O 流量類型,可以從處理器高速緩存直接發(fā)送I/O,從而加大了分發(fā)節(jié)點(diǎn)的帶寬,消除不必要的內(nèi)存訪問(wèn)。另外,至強(qiáng)E5處理器還在微處理器中集成了支持PCI Express 3.0標(biāo)準(zhǔn)的I/O控制器。與前一代產(chǎn)品相比,這一功能可使I/O延遲降低30%,而且在與PCI Express 3.0進(jìn)行組合之后,它還能提供三倍以上的吞吐率。這種技術(shù)提升幫助藍(lán)汛加強(qiáng)了在大數(shù)據(jù)上的分發(fā)能力,做到快速響應(yīng)、高速下載,避免任務(wù)堆積。
優(yōu)異的計(jì)算能力和存儲(chǔ)能力已經(jīng)從底層架構(gòu)起了藍(lán)汛的未來(lái),為公司面向傳統(tǒng)企業(yè)和移動(dòng)互聯(lián)網(wǎng)的戰(zhàn)略轉(zhuǎn)型奠定了基礎(chǔ)。宗劼表示:“通過(guò)前瞻性的底層架構(gòu)設(shè)計(jì),我們能夠在云計(jì)算和大數(shù)據(jù)時(shí)代為用戶提供更好的體驗(yàn)和服務(wù)。我們下一步考慮能夠進(jìn)入到萬(wàn)兆網(wǎng)卡的使用上,以提高我們的網(wǎng)絡(luò)支撐能力。最初我們一臺(tái)服務(wù)器使用一塊千兆的網(wǎng)卡,現(xiàn)在好的話能夠集成四塊千兆的網(wǎng)卡,再通過(guò)捆綁技術(shù),最高峰的時(shí)候單臺(tái)服務(wù)器能跑到2到3個(gè)G,但這在云計(jì)算和大數(shù)據(jù)時(shí)代是遠(yuǎn)遠(yuǎn)不夠的,所以我們也在逐步轉(zhuǎn)向萬(wàn)兆網(wǎng)卡以突破數(shù)據(jù)傳輸?shù)钠款i?!?/p>